WebDec 12, 2015 · The amide nitrogen technically has a lone pair and thus technically could function as a hydrogen bond acceptor when viewed alone. However, this lone pair is actually significantly delocalised towards the carbonyl bond. WebTo find the total number of atoms in CO(NH2)2 (Urea) we’ll add up the number of each type of atom. The small number after the element symbol is called the subscript and this tells us how many of that atom are in the compound. For example, H2 means there are two Hydrogen atoms. NH2- has an sp3 hybridization type. The central Nitrogen atomhas four regions which are responsible for identifying hybridization. Here Nhas two unbonded electrons pairs and two sigma bonds. And due to these four regionsaround the central nitrogen atom, NH2- has sp3 hybridization.
